    John P.

    Finally, a boba shop that actually has the avocado smoothie in stock! Most places sell out because it's so popular, but Foam came through--and with real avocado too. Their avocado smoothie was incredibly fresh, creamy, and not overly sweet. The boba was perfectly chewy and tasted super fresh, making it even better. Definitely coming back for more!

    Kathy L.

    I've been to this place a handful of times. They close early, so it's hard for me to visit regularly. Many times it after I eat pho next door and I'm too late. It's been unusually warm and I was able to stop by for early afternoon refreshment. I was surprised to see that they offer sugar cane juice--perfect drink for a hot Indian summer day. I ordered the passionfruit sugarcane juice and it was very refreshing, naturally sweet--no added sugars. It's a small shop with limited seating, but it's nice that they offer seating. The person behind the counter was super friendly. You can order on the kiosk, if paying by card or at the counter if by cash. They are also located up the block from Sarang Hello and across the street from the post office. If want refreshments/snacks after errands, it's a great place to take a break. Looking forward to my next visit.

    Michele T.

    Craving popcorn chicken and there aren't too many places we know that make them nowadays in our neighborhood. After a quick search, hubs suggested trying Foam Tea House. Small place, but there were a couple of tables and seating along the window. We ordered at the kiosk - roasted oolong milk tea w/ grass jelly, Thai tea, popcorn chicken and fries. Drinks came out quickly. I ordered the roasted oolong with 30% sugar and less ice. I tend to like my teas strong, and this was a little weak for me. Hubs ordered the Thai tea, which was good. Faves were the snacks as they were made to order and came out hot and crispy. Popcorn chicken was crispy and perfect amount of saltiness. Fries were also hot, and I enjoyed them with the Sriracha ketchup. Hubs and I agreed that we'd each order our own fries and popcorn chicken next time. Would love if they offered a combo deal.

    Eugene A.

    One of my besties and I were in the mood for our boba fix this past weekend. Since both of us prefer dairy alternatives, thankfully Foam offers their milk teas with Almond Milk. Both of us ordered a Matcha Milk Tea with boba in Almond Milk. Our orders were ready within 2 minutes. They give generous portions of matcha that it covered at least half of our drink. The matcha flavor was not too overpowering and it blended well with the almond milk tea's sweetness. The boba was perfectly chewy, sweet and not tough. The ambiance was impressive because of their printed cup event dedicated to Jihyo's solo release. As a Once (Twice stan), I was truly fond of the posters and the provided cups and photocards. Foam frequently collaborates with Saranghello for any cupsleeve or printed cup events. Moving forward, Foam is now my go-to boba shop along Taraval Street in San Francisco's Sunset district!

    Do you eat/drink the images on the foam?

    Yes! It is edible and has no added flavor.

    What are your non caffeinated boba tea options?

    Sure. We have varieties of non caffeinated options, such as Must try Ice Milk and Tonic. Thank you for your support!

    Will you use a reusable cup like a mason jar if I bring one?

    Yes, we encourage our customers to bring in with clean reusable cup and many of our regular customers actually did!

    Do you serve hot drinks with the printed "foam" on top?

    Sorry, we don’t serve printed hot drinks. We have experimented with it before and the heat would just melt the printed foam.
